Before leaving the factory, the equipment must undergo a demisting performance test, with the mist removal efficiency of the mesh demister being no less than 93%. How is this experiment done? What instrument should be used for testing? Please advise.

This post was last edited by luoli519 on 2017-10-7 at 19:21. The demisting efficiency of the mesh demister must reach 95%! For high-efficiency gas-liquid separators with feather-shaped vanes, the demisting efficiency must be over 99%. Regarding the demisting efficiency of gas-liquid separation demisters, professional testing methods such as X-ray small-angle scattering, powder target method, GC method, and humidity method are available. If the owner chooses a non-professional demister manufacturer, it will naturally be difficult to implement this method, as well as to ensure its actual operational efficiency. Third-party testing can be commissioned.
